Careful consideration should be given to the placement of transmitter and detector to ensure that the mounting points are stable and not subject to vibration or motion, as misalignment of the infrared beam will cause a loss of sensitivity and eventually a detector fault. Although modern open path detectors are relatively immune to adverse conditions such as rain, snow or fog, it is always advisable to include rain / sun covers for the open path transmitter and receiver to minimize temperature variation and reduce the possibility that moisture will enter the sealed enclosures. Unlike a point gas detector that measures the amount of gas present in a specific area, an open path detector measures the quantity of gas in an area that covers the entire distance between transmitter and receiver. Open path gas detectors are designed to detect the presence of combustible levels of hydrocarbon gases in open areas or along fence lines. This allows a single open path detector to monitor a much larger area; however, since the open path detector cannot tell the difference between a large diffuse cloud of gas spread across the entire detection area and a small concentrated leak, a mixture of open path detectors and point detectors is often the best choice for industrial applications.
